Use of technology will enable HR to achieve three key objectives that is?

Technology can help HR achieve three key objectives: efficiency, data-driven decision making, and employee engagement and experience.

Step-by-step explanation:

Technology can help HR achieve three key objectives:

  1. Efficiency: Technology can streamline HR processes, such as recruiting, onboarding, and payroll. It can automate repetitive tasks, freeing up HR professionals to focus on strategic initiatives.
  2. Data-driven decision making: Technology enables HR to collect and analyze employee data, such as performance metrics and engagement levels. This data can inform HR decisions and contribute to a more informed and effective workforce management.
  3. Employee engagement and experience: Technology can provide employees with tools and platforms to engage with HR, access HR information, and participate in professional development. This fosters a positive employee experience and promotes a culture of continuous learning and growth.

By leveraging technology effectively, HR can enhance organizational performance, improve employee satisfaction, and drive business success.
